-
JSDoc자바스크립트[JavaScript] 2017. 9. 12. 10:24
JSDoc
JSDoc은 javascript 모듈에서 사용되는 각각의 클래스, 함수들에 대한 정의를
JSDoc에서 정의한 표준 주석양식에 맞춰 작성하게 되면 그에따른 자동화된 개발 래퍼런스 문서가 만들어지게 된다.
마크다운 문서로 래퍼런스 문서를 제공하여 gitbook 같은 호스팅 서비스에 등재하게 되면 하나의 인쇄물로서 출력도 가능하다.
이러한 방법은 개발자가 일일히 래퍼런스 문서를 만들지 않아도 래퍼런스 문서를 만들 수 있는 이점이 있으며
표준화된 주석 사용으로 협업 및 인수인계가 원할하게 된다. 사실 다른 Doc 툴도 있지만 해당 서비스가 가장 유력하다.
https://github.com/jsdoc3/jsdoc
JSDoc 샘플링한 문서도 같이 올려봅니다.ㅎ
test.js 파일
=============================================
/** This is a description of the foo function. */
function foo() {
}
/**
* Represents a book.
* @constructor
*/
function Book(title, author) {
}
/**
* Represents a book.
* @constructor
* @param {string} title - 제목.
* @param {string} author - 저자.
*/
function Book(title, author) {
}
=============================================
'자바스크립트[JavaScript]' 카테고리의 다른 글
JSON.parse(), JSON.stringify() (0) 2017.06.30 모바일웹 터치 이벤트 touchstart, touchmove, touchend, touchcancel (0) 2017.06.28 모바일 PC 여부확인 테스트 (0) 2017.04.25 JavaScript[자바스크립트] Confirm 대화상자 삭제하시겠습니까? (1) 2017.01.23 JavaScript[자바스크립트] setTimeout() 사용방법!! 일정시간뒤에 실행 (0) 2017.01.11